Tribological Evaluation of Powder Type Mold Release Lubricant for Aluminum Die Casting
In order to develop guidelines for developing lubricants of high performance for aluminum die casting, we conducted tribological evaluation tests on the thermal and lubricating characteristics of inorganic powders and waxes.
